Best Sealer for Limestone Pavers Orange County FL
Choosing the best sealer for limestone pavers requires a unique strategy than for traditional pavers. Limestone is a delicate yet elegant stone that needs to "breathe". Therefore, the recommended choice is a penetrating, breathable formula, typically a silane/siloxane blend. This type of sealer works by penetrating the limestone's tiny pores and creating a hydrophobic barrier from within, rather than forming a film on top. This is crucial because it blocks moisture and dirt, while still letting internal moisture release. A film-forming sealer, like a plastic-like product, can lock in vapor, which can result in discoloration and breakdown. For maintaining the authentic appearance and strength of limestone, a penetrating, natural-finish sealer is always the best recommendation.

Paver Sealers Orange County FL
Paver sealers are high-performance finishes designed to preserve and beautify natural stone pavers. They come in a large selection of options to suit different requirements and visual tastes. The two main categories are eco-friendly and chemical-based sealers. Water-based options are eco-friendlier with low VOCs and typically provide a matte finish. Solvent-based sealers are known for their strong tone enrichment, often creating a shiny finish with a satin result. Within these categories, you can find absorptive types that bond internally without modifying the surface, and layered protectants that create a protective layer on top. Choosing the right paver sealer depends on the type of paver, appearance goal, and the amount of durability expected.

- The Water Droplet Test: I place a few droplets of water on a clean, dry paver. If the water beads and sits for over a minute, I'm dealing with a low-porosity paver that requires a film-forming acrylic sealer for proper adhesion. If the water absorbs in under 30 seconds, it's a high-porosity paver, and a penetrating, non-film-forming silane/siloxane sealer is the only professional choice to avoid a blotchy, uneven finish.
- The Plastic Sheet Test: This is my go-to for detecting efflorescence-causing moisture. After the patio is clean and has been dry for at least 48 hours in the sun, I tape a 1x1 foot square of clear plastic sheeting flat against the pavers in a central area. After 12-24 hours, I check for condensation on the underside. Any visible moisture is a hard stop. Proceeding will trap this moisture under the sealer, causing the dreaded white haze. I once saw a massive commercial project fail because the crew sealed it a day after pressure washing, trapping gallons of water in the base.
- Aggressive Surface Decontamination: This is more than a simple rinse. I use a high-PSI pressure washer with a specialized efflorescence remover and degreaser to deep clean not just the surface but the paver pores. After cleaning, I use a leaf blower to force all fine particulate matter out of the joints and pores.
- Joint Stabilization: Empty or failing joints are a primary failure point. I top off all joints with a high-quality polymeric sand, ensuring it's properly swept, compacted, and activated according to the manufacturer's specific instructions. This creates a monolithic, weed-resistant surface.
- The Critical Drying Phase: The patio must be bone dry. This means a minimum of 48 hours of no rain with low humidity after cleaning and sanding. I always re-verify with the plastic sheet test if there's any doubt.
- Sealer Application: For penetrating sealers, I use a technique called a flood coat, applying a heavy layer with a sprayer and then using a foam roller to back-roll the excess for a uniform, matte finish. For film-forming acrylics, two thin, even coats applied with a high-quality, solvent-resistant roller are essential to prevent roller marks and build a consistent gloss. The key is maintaining a wet edge at all times.
- Curing & Quality Control: The patio is off-limits to foot traffic for at least 24 hours and to vehicle traffic or furniture for 72 hours. This allows the polymer chains in the sealer to fully cross-link and achieve maximum hardness and chemical resistance.
